ROMAN EMPIRE. Trajan. 98-117 AD. Æ Sestertius (24.70 gm; 32 mm). Rome, 115 AD. Obv: IMP CAES NER TRAIANO OPTIMO AVG GER DAC P M TR P COS VI P P Bust laureate, draped r., seen from side. Rx: IMPERATOR VIIII / S C in two lines in exergue, the army saluting Trajan "imperator", commemorating the first three victories of Trajan's Parthian war, IMP VII being accorded for his conquest of Armenia in 114, IMP VIII and VIIII for the first two victories of his second campaign in 115. MIR-549v (71 spec.), BM 1019; Paris 844; Cohen 178 (25 Fr.); RIC 657. Lovely strike on a nice full flan. Well centered. Choice EF. Nice original reddish-green patina. Ex Frank Kovacs.
